Saturday, February 11, 2017

Allison Crutchfield - Dean's Room

Former member of the indie group Swearin, Allison Crutchfield channels the emotions from the breakup with its guitarist and the dissolution of the group into a heartfelt and beat heavy solo debut, Tourist In This Town. I loved all 3 songs on my Jan 2017 AllMusic Editors’ Choice playlist. They are just what I like to hear - passionate indie rock with a great beat. 
Here’s Dean’s Room :

No comments:

Post a Comment